Blue Light is everywhere today. It shines from our phones, TVs, laptops, streetlights, and homes. Most people never stop to wonder where it came from or who made it possible. The story of Blue Light is not just about technology. It is about persistence, failure, and one scientist who refused to give up. That scientist was Shuji Nakamura.
This breakthrough changed how the world uses energy, how screens work, and how modern lighting looks. It also reshaped entire industries and significantly reduced global power use.
